Abstract

The utility model discloses an intelligent public transport query system based on RFID and a two-dimensional code. The intelligent public transport query system comprises a vehicle terminal, a public transport server and a public transport station, wherein the vehicle terminal carries out timely acquisition of vehicle travelling information by reading an RFID electronic label at the public transport station and transmits processed data to the public transport server through a wireless network, the public transport server receives the data, carries out information processing, stores the information and provides query service, and the two-dimensional code at the public transport station can provide an on-site intelligent public transport query approach. The intelligent public transport query system has a reasonable structure, is simple and practical, realizes combination of RFID technology and the two-dimensional code, can realize timely acquisition of dynamic vehicle information, fixed point trigger forecast for station arriving of a vehicle, one key type route and on-site intelligent query of vehicle travelling information.

Description

A kind of intelligent bus inquiry system based on RFID and two-dimension code
Technical field
The utility model relates to a kind of public transportation enquiry system, is specifically related to a kind of intelligent bus inquiry system based on RFID and two-dimension code.
Background technology
Along with the development of society, the energy-conservation mainstream of society that become, bus becomes the first-selection of people's short distance trip.But for most of citizen, be a thing of making us the mood anxiety Deng bus, now where or how long also will wait generally have no way of finding out about it the bus that will wait, and this problem shows particularly outstanding in the most of circuits of metropolitan suburbs circuit or small and medium-sized cities.How setting up the interactive mode of a kind of passenger and public traffic management system and link up approach, to make things convenient for passenger's trip, improve the operational efficiency of public transit vehicle simultaneously, is a problem that presses for solution.
Existing intelligent public transportation system generally adopts the GPS technology to monitor in real time, shows information of vehicles (as traveling-position, speed, vehicle condition etc.) on electronic public transport stop board in real time, and the passenger can in time grasp route conditions after checking electronic stop plate.At present intelligent public transportation system mainly exist as: gps signal be subject to barrier influence and unstable, as to have ignored passenger and public traffic management system interactive mode link up inquire about, electronic public transport stop board need drop into a large amount of funds at first stage of construction, owing to electronic public transport stop board very easily damages or the stolen more high a series of problems of its later maintenance cost that cause, therefore in the most of circuits in metropolitan suburbs or small and medium-sized cities, generally be difficult to the real intelligent public transportation system of implementing simultaneously.
The utility model content
The utility model purpose: the purpose of this utility model is in order to solve deficiency of the prior art, a kind of rational in infrastructure, simple and practical intelligent bus inquiry system is provided, in conjunction with RFID technology and two-dimension code, realize the site intelligent inquiry system of fixed point triggering forecast, " one-touch " route and vehicle traveling information that vehicle dynamic real time information sampling, vehicle arrive at a station.
Technical scheme: a kind of intelligent bus inquiry system based on RFID and two-dimension code described in the utility model, comprise car-mounted terminal, the public transport platform, station board and public transport server, described car-mounted terminal comprises public transport information acquisition module, Bus information processing module, onboard wireless communication module and the vehicle forecast module of arriving at a station, described public transport information acquisition module is connected with described Bus information processing module, and described Bus information processing module is connected with onboard wireless communication module and the vehicle forecast module of arriving at a station; Described public transport platform is provided with RFID electronic tag and platform two-dimension code, and described station board is provided with the station board two-dimension code; Described public transport server comprises wireless communication module and the database server of data, services is provided.
As preferably, be provided with the RFID reader in the described public transport information acquisition module, be used for perception and read in the induction range public transport platform subtab information that powers on.
As preferably, described onboard wireless communication module and wireless communication module are the GPS communication module, carry out data communication by wireless network.
Principle of work of the present utility model is: car-mounted terminal carries out the real-time collection of vehicle traveling information and transmits data by wireless network to the public transport server after treatment by the RFID electronic tag of reading the public transport platform, the public transport server carries out information processing, stores and provides inquiry service after receiving data, two-dimension code on the public transport platform can provide site intelligent public transportation enquiry approach, during the two-dimension code inquiry, at first take two-dimension code and parsing with mobile phone, can carry out " one-touch " inquiry of multiple modes such as network, note, phone then, concrete query contents is as follows:
A. inquire about the traveling state of vehicle (how long need as reaching our station the soonest, this car travels position etc.) of certain bar circuit;
B. inquire about the route or travel by vehicle (as platform along the line, shopping supermarket, tourist attractions, school etc.) of certain bar circuit;
C. inquire about current platform to the circuit selectable of certain destination (or platform), and provide that accumulative total public transport price is minimum, the public bus network informational strategy under distance several situations such as minimum the shortest, consuming time.
Beneficial effect: a kind of intelligent bus inquiry system based on RFID and two-dimension code described in the utility model has the following advantages:
1. the utility model is rational in infrastructure, simple and practical, do not need existing platform is carried out electronic station board transformation, the RFID electronic tag of a cheapness need only be installed, not only greatly reduce early investment and maintenance cost, and owing to the electronic tag volume is easy to hide for a short time, can effectively avoid malice to damage or theft, thereby improve security and the stability of system;
2. the utility model adopts the information of arriving at a station to trigger to carry out communication, and system need not to connect for a long time network, can cut operating costs greatly, adopts the public transport forecast of arriving at a station can avoid the manual operations of calling out the stops of driver's button for a long time simultaneously, reduces misinformation probability;
3. the utility model provides the intelligent bus inquiry service to the passenger, take two-dimension code by mobile phone, can " one-touch " inquire (multiple inquiry modes such as network address, note, phone) corresponding bus routes and vehicle traveling information---the traveling state of vehicle of certain bar circuit, travel route, current platform is to the circuit selectable of certain destination or selection strategy etc., improve passenger's bus trip greatly and experience, improved intelligent level, the lifting public transport image of public transportation enquiry system management simultaneously.
